Squab, also known as young pigeon, is a delicacy served in fine dining restaurants.
About:
Squab can pe prepared similarly to poultry by roasting, pan-frying, or braising, cooking until medium-rare or medium-well.
Did you know?
- Squab is often compared to dark meat chicken or duck.
- There is less fat and more protein in squab meat, making it popular in many cultures.
- Squab meat is dark, tender, and rich flavour.
